Abstract
A pouring cap for bottles constituted by a molded part as a capsule provided with a substantially cylindrical skirt provided on its inner face with a circumferential rib adapted to snap into a corresponding peripheral neck neck narrowing of a concentric inner cylindrical neck said skirt and adapted to fit into the mouth of the bottle and opposite this inner neck of an outer cylindrical neck provided with a peripheral rim adapted for fitting thereon a closure cap provided internally with a circumferential rib of retention complementary to said rim characterized in that the portion of the upper wall of the cap encircled by said outer cylindrical neck has a slight slope with respect to the general plane of said upper wall as well as a hollow central cylindrical appendage as an open weir at its starting end and closed at its extremity or free by a flat portion inclined in the same direction as said portion but more pronounced than it and forming a body with the appendix itself serves as a seal for the cap.
